col
Pronunciación: [kɒl]
Palabra
Contexto: «geography»
(noun) a low point between two mountains or hills. It’s like a little path or gap that sits lower than the peaks around it. People often use cols to cross over mountains.
Ejemplo
The hikers reached the col and were excited to see the view from the top.
Ejemplo
They didn't find a col to rest at; the mountains were too steep.
Ejemplo
Have you ever crossed a col on a hike?
